Isolated large primary splenic hydatid cyst: A case report

Journal Title: Asian Pacific Journal of Tropical Disease - Year 2015, Vol 5, Issue 0

Abstract

Hydatid cysts of the spleen are uncommon (2-3.5%). Primary involvement of the spleen is even rarer. We present a case of a large primary hydatid cyst of the spleen in a 55-year-old woman. Diagnosis was based on computed tomography (CT) scan along with a high degree of clinical suspicion. En-masse excision was successfully performed, and the patient was discharged with prophylactic albendazole therapy. Unless there is a high degree of clinical suspicion, this lifethreatening condition may be missed; hence, the importance of this report.
